1854 U.S. Congressional Medal for Commander Duncan Ingraham

Item Details

An 1854 U.S. Congressional Medal for Commander Duncan Ingraham. The round, bronze medal is marked ‘Presented by the President of the United States to Commander Duncan N. Ingraham as a testimonial of the high sense entertained by Congress of his gallant and judicious conduct on the 2d of July 1853 – Joint Resolution of Congress August 4th 1854’. Commander Ingraham was commended for his actions at Smyrna, where he was instrumental in rescuing from captivity a Hungarian who wished to become an American citizen. The medal was designed by S. Eastman; obverse was sculpted by Peter Cross; reverse sculpted by James Longacre.
